Baseball Preview: Indy Genesis HomeSchool Indy Genesis vs. Triton Central Tigers
The Indy Genesis HomeSchool Indy Genesis will head out on the road to challenge the Triton Central Tigers at 10:00 a.m. on Saturday. The last three games Indy Genesis HomeSchool has played have been within two runs, so don't be surprised if it's a close one.
Indy Genesis HomeSchool gave up the first runs last Saturday, but they didn't let that get them down. They narrowly escaped with a win as the team sidled past Fort Wayne Crusaders 6-5. That's two games straight that Indy Genesis HomeSchool has won by just one run.
Jordan Jaramillo was a major factor no matter where he played. On the mound, he tossed an inning while giving up no earned runs off one hit. Jaramillo was also stellar in the batter's box, scoring two runs while getting on base in all four of his plate appearances.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Davin Althoff, who went 2-for-3 with two doubles and two RBI. Keyton Smith was another key contributor, scoring two runs while going 2-for-3.
Meanwhile, Triton Central entered their tilt with Indianapolis Scecina Memorial with two cons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with three. They came out on top against the Crusaders by a score of 6-1 on Wednesday.
Hayden May sp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ered one run (which was unearned) on three hits and racked up seven Ks.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in five cons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Kellan Dishman, who scored two runs and stole a base while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Another player making a difference was Eli Sego, who scored a run and stole a base while going 2-for-4.
Indy Genesis HomeSchool is on a roll lately: they've won three of their last four mat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 6-3-1 record this season. As for Triton Central, their record now sits at 12-1.
Saturday's game might come down to which pitcher can control the ball better. Indy Genesis HomeSchool has hit smart this season, having averaged an OBP of .468. However, it's not like Triton Central struggles in that department as they've averaged .524. With both teams so capable at the plate, fans should be ready for an impressive hitting performance.
